According to Stratistics MRC, the Global Cloud Encryption Market is accounted for $5.22 billion in 2025 and is expected to reach $32.08 billion by 2032 growing at a CAGR of 29.6% during the forecast period. Cloud encryption is the process of converting data into a secure format before storing it in the cloud, ensuring only authorized users can access it. It protects sensitive information from breaches, misuse, and unauthorized access. As cloud adoption grows across industries, encryption plays a vital role in maintaining data privacy, regulatory compliance, and trust in digital ecosystems.
According to the Encryption Consulting Global Encryption Trends 2023 report, 68% of organizations were utilizing cloud platforms to store and process sensitive data, while 58% had implemented one or more encryption technologies to safeguard that data in the cloud.
Escalating cybersecurity threats
The proliferation of sophisticated cyberattacks across cloud environments has emerged as a primary driver for cloud encryption market expansion. Organizations face mounting pressure from ransomware, data breaches, and advanced persistent threats targeting cloud-stored sensitive information. Furthermore, the evolution of attack vectors has prompted enterprises to prioritize robust encryption mechanisms as essential defense layers. The frequency of high-profile security incidents has heightened awareness among decision-makers regarding the critical importance of protecting data at rest and in transit within cloud infrastructures.
High costs of encryption solutions
Implementation expenses associated with comprehensive cloud encryption deployments present significant barriers for many organizations, particularly small and medium enterprises. The financial burden encompasses licensing fees, infrastructure upgrades, ongoing maintenance costs, and specialized personnel training requirements. Additionally, performance overhead concerns and integration complexities can drive up the total cost of ownership substantially.
Expansion of managed security services
Organizations increasingly seek comprehensive security solutions that reduce internal resource requirements while maintaining robust protection standards. Moreover, the shift toward remote work environments has accelerated demand for managed encryption services that can seamlessly protect distributed workforces. Service providers are capitalizing on this trend by developing innovative offerings that combine encryption capabilities with ongoing monitoring, compliance management, and threat response services.
Data sovereignty and geo-sovereignty barriers
Regulatory frameworks mandating data residency within specific geographic boundaries pose significant challenges for cloud encryption market growth. Organizations operating across multiple jurisdictions must navigate complex compliance requirements that may restrict encryption key management and data processing locations. Furthermore, evolving government regulations regarding data sovereignty create uncertainty for enterprises seeking unified encryption strategies. These barriers can fragment market opportunities and necessitate region-specific solutions that increase deployment complexity and operational costs for global organizations.
The Covid-19 pandemic accelerated cloud adoption and remote work implementations, driving unprecedented demand for cloud encryption solutions. Organizations rapidly transitioned to cloud-based collaboration platforms, creating urgent needs for data protection mechanisms. However, budget constraints and operational disruptions initially slowed some encryption deployments. The crisis ultimately strengthened long-term market prospects as enterprises recognized the critical importance of securing distributed digital infrastructures and protecting sensitive information in increasingly cloud-dependent business models.

In January 2025, Telefonica Tech, the digital business unit of the Spanish telecommunications group Telefonica, and IBM a pioneer in quantum-safe cryptography, today announced a collaboration agreement to develop and deliver security solutions that address security challenges posed by future cryptographically relevant quantum computers.
In November 2024, Thales, the leading global technology and security provider announces the availability of CipherTrust Transparent Encryption (CTE) through the CipherTrust Data Security Platform as-a-service. CTE is designed to provide transparent, high-performance encryption for complex environments without the need to modify applications or underlying infrastructure. In continuing to expand its cloud service offerings, Thales remains committed to providing customers with a choice in how they consume data security services to help achieve compliance and protect sensitive data wherever it resides.
In August 2024, Two IBM-developed algorithms have been officially published among the first three post-quantum cryptography standards, announced today by the U.S. Department of Commerce's National Institute of Standards and Technology (NIST).
